Strobic Tri-Stack laboratory fume hood exhaust systems meet requirements of ANSI Z9.5 (1992), American National Standard for Laboratory Ventilation. The award winning Tri-Stack systems are available for single exhaust or manifold systems on a common plenum up to 240,000 cfm. They offer maintenance free, continuous operation. Unsightly tall stacks, with associated expensive mounting hardware and guy wires are eliminated. And Tri-Stack reduces static pressure in the system by approximately 2" w.g., at an annual average savings of 44 cents per cfm.
